| Abstract | We previously showed that extended 4-week anneals at 1223 K were required to achieve structural and chemical homogeneity in the off-stoichiometric Ni-Mn-Sn Heusler alloy solid solution. To insure that the transition from the high temperature B2 to the room temperature L2(1) phase was complete, we performed low temperature (773 K) anneals, similar to 150 K below the reported B2 -> L2(1) transition temperature, on the 1223 K homogenized samples. Drastic changes in the magnetization measurements of the annealed samples suggested that the intermediate compositions of the L2(1) phase were metastable. TEM and XRD analyses confirmed the decomposition of the single-phase Heusler alloys into two phases with compositions close to Ni54Mn45Sn1 and Ni50Mn35Sn20. The observed phase decomposition indicated that the off-stoichiometric Ni-Mn-Sn Heusler alloys, that feature martensitic transformations, are metastable at 773 K. (c) 2009 Elsevier B.V.
